Transaction 7585a7ce37934793488c610af6095f893e54371b7341dfcf2bfa7848b6439ab1
2 Input
2 Outputs
- 7585a7ce37934793488c610af6095f893e54371b7341dfcf2bfa7848b6439ab1:0
- 7585a7ce37934793488c610af6095f893e54371b7341dfcf2bfa7848b6439ab1:1
value 33247812
address 1BTYNGLrvWZZu59z3SynqmB7HUXKsiiPNU
value 166747700
address 1MrVV659hp6pULNU45pPKn66guiyFFCYm8